What does "ignore contact" do in news groups?
Hi,If I check "Ignore contact" for someone posting to a news group what does actually happen? I see they get a little red icon added in the message list, but the post is still there and they are not ignored according to my use of the term
Could someone explain how "ignore contact" works or is supposed to work?Ignored contacts have their messages automatically marked as read, do not show in auto-complete and have a red icon next to them.
There's no "View -> Show -> Show ignored" that you can uncheck for each message list. That'd be a good feature request though. If you want that, you'll have to create a filter for the contact and set "mark messages as filtered".
